First Unitarian Congregation of Ottawa

The First Unitarian Congregation of Ottawa invites all those who seek after greater understanding and who are willing to work with others to build a better world to join us: for services on Sundays, for numerous volunteer efforts in our community at various times, and on this itunes account at any time, from anywhere.

This podcast serves as an online home for the broadcast and archiving of Sunday Sermons and other offerings from the pulpit at 30 Cleary Avenue, Ottawa, Ontario, Canada.
